

Man has also colonized several outer space locations, including Mercury, the Moon, Mars and several other moons. Set a few hundred years in the future, Earth has created a monitoring agency for asteroids after a large one has crashed into the Earth. Out of all the award winners I’ve read, this book was closest in plot and style to Ringworld by Larry Niven, however I enjoyed this book even more as the pace was very brisk and Clarke built excellent suspense despite little action.

Clarke tells a classic story of first contact with an alien presence, but makes it entirely original by changing the location of the meeting to an outer space vessel that is possibly abandoned. Much like The Gods Themselves by Isaac Asimov, Rendezvous with Rama is an excellent throwback science fiction novel by a master of the genre.
